Fog’s effects linger

Two Air New Zealand domestic flights were cancelled yesterday morning because the aircraft due to fly had not been able to land in Christchurch the previous evening because of thick fog. The cancelled flights were the first morning flights to Auckland and to Dunedin.

All other flights left on schedule after the fog cleared about 6.30 a.m. Passengers on the 10 domestic flights which were cancelled on Tuesday were all rebooked and carried to their destinations yesterday morning.
